What is being bought

The provision of R-Link wearable health and safety monitoring equipment and access to the Reactec Analytics platform. The solution supports the Council's statutory duties under the Health and Safety at Work etc. Act 1974 and the Control of Vibration at Work Regulations 2005 by enabling accurate monitoring and management of Hand Arm Vibration (HAV) exposure, alongside proximity warning functionality for plant and vehicle interface risks. The arrangement is delivered under Reactec's "Safety as a Service" model, which provides: New hardware supplied as part of the service Ongoing software access, analytics, and support Replacement of faulty equipment within agreed timescales No capital asset ownership by the Council This approach ensures continuity of data, avoids obsolescence of equipment, and provides predictable revenue costs Method of calculating the contract value The total contract value has been calculated based on the aggregated cost of the Reactec service plans required across multiple service areas, as detailed in the supplier's commercial proposal. The calculation includes: The number of R-Link devices required per service area. Associated gateways, charging stations and consumables. A fixed annual SaaS service charge per device. A three-year contract term, with costs expressed exclusive of VAT. The supplier has provided a clear breakdown by service area, with an agreed discounted total applied across the deployment. The contract value represents the sum of all annual service charges over the three-year fixed term, as set out in the proposal. There are no additional hidden costs, capital purchase costs, or variable usage charges within the term.
